Amycus
Amycus (Amy´cus) was king of Bebrycia. He was a son of [[Neptune (mythology)]], and was killed by [[Pollux (mythology)]]. |

Amalthaea
Amalthaea (Amal´thae´a), the goat which nourished [[Jupiter (mythology)]]. |
